Output 86fcc13ca6059d0694bb2453b9a5aeaeefc28fc842e731694478897e064514b7:1

value
8425256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49944895c22eb749e43eea86fb7b35bcf30dbf35 OP_EQUAL
address
38Q4tU6fZRM5EqEsEiNtR1LrfdpvSUTcAg
transaction
86fcc13ca6059d0694bb2453b9a5aeaeefc28fc842e731694478897e064514b7
confirmations
461724
spent
true